#38EB0A Hex Color Code

#38EB0A

The Hexadecimal Color #38EB0A is a contrast shade of Lime Green. #38EB0A RGB value is rgb(56, 235, 10). RGB Color Model of #38EB0A consists of 21% red, 92% green and 3% blue. HSL color Mode of #38EB0A has 108°(degrees) Hue, 92% Saturation and 48% Lightness. #38EB0A color has an wavelength of 552n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#38EB0A is #66FF33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#38EB0A is #3E1. The Closest Color to #38EB0A is #32CD32. Official Name of #38EB0A Hex Code is Harlequin.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#38EB0A is 76 Cyan 0 Magenta 96 Yellow 8 Black and #38EB0A CMY is 76, 0, 96.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#38EB0A is hsl(108,92,48,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(108, 96, 92).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#38EB0A is 31.39, 60.28, 10.27.
Hex8 Value of #38EB0A is #38EB0AFF. Decimal Value of #38EB0A is 3730186 and Octal Value of #38EB0A is 16165412. Binary Value of #38EB0A is 111000, 11101011, 1010 and Android of #38EB0A is 4281920266 / 0xff38eb0a.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#38EB0A is 0.308, 0.591, 0.591 and YIQ Color Space of #38EB0A is 155.829, -34.3736, -107.8785.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#38EB0A is 47.23, 80.3, 11.01.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#38EB0A is 81.99, -76.76, 77.91.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#38EB0A is 81.99, -72.39, 99.16.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#38EB0A is 81.99, 109.37, 134.57. Hunter Lab variable of #38EB0A is 77.64, -63.7, 46.51.

Various Color Shades of #38EB0A

To get 25% Saturated #38EB0A Color, you need to convert the hex color #38EB0A to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#38EB0A h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#38EB0A

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
